Significance of Nourishment in Neck And Back Pain



Nourishment plays a crucial duty in taking care of neck and back pain. Your diet can considerably influence inflammation degrees and general discomfort levels in your back. Consuming a balanced diet regimen rich in nutrients like vitamins D and K, calcium, magnesium, and omega-3 fats can help in reducing swelling and enhance bones, which are important for back health and wellness.

Additionally, keeping a healthy and balanced weight with correct nourishment can ease stress and anxiety on your spinal column, reducing the risk of pain in the back.

In addition, certain nutrients like anti-oxidants discovered in vegetables and fruits can assist battle oxidative stress and advertise recovery in the body, including the back muscular tissues and back.

On the other hand, eating extreme amounts of refined foods, sweet drinks, and undesirable fats can contribute to inflammation and weight gain, worsening neck and back pain.

Foods to Eat for Back Health And Wellness



To support a healthy and balanced back, incorporating nutrient-rich foods right into your daily meals is crucial. Including foods high in anti-oxidants like berries, spinach, and kale can help in reducing swelling in your back, easing pain and discomfort. Omega-3 fatty acids discovered in fatty fish such as salmon and mackerel have anti-inflammatory buildings that can profit your back health and wellness.

In addition, consuming nuts and seeds like almonds, walnuts, and chia seeds offers necessary nutrients like magnesium and vitamin E, which sustain muscular tissue function and minimize oxidative stress. Incorporating lean proteins such as poultry, turkey, and tofu can help in muscle mass fixing and maintenance, advertising a solid back.

Don't neglect to include milk or fortified plant-based alternatives for calcium to support bone health. Finally, moisten with a lot of water to maintain your spine discs moistened and working ideally. By consisting of these nutrient-dense foods in your diet plan, you can nourish your back and support overall spinal health.
